About Quartet
Quartet is a 2012 movie in the Drama, Comedy and Romance genres, directed by Dustin Hoffman, starring Maggie Smith, Tom Courtenay and Billy Connolly. It has a runtime of 1 hour 38 minutes. It holds an average rating of 6.5/10 from 388 viewers. Overview
Cissy, Reggie, and Wilf are in a home for retired musicians. Every year, there is a concert to celebrate Composer Giuseppe Verdi's birthday and they take part. Jean, who used to be married to Reggie, arrives at the home and disrupts their equilibrium. She still acts like a diva, but she refuses to sing. Still, the show must go on, and it does.
